Middlesbrough and former Sheffield United manager Chris Wilder has emerged as the bookmakers’ favorite to replace Sean Dyche as Burnley’s new manager.
SkyBet have Wilder as 4/5 favorites to replace Dyche, who the Clarets dismissed on Friday with Burnley in danger of seeing their six-year stay in the top flight come to an end this season. Boro de Wilder’s side are currently ninth and three points clear of the Championship play-off places with just four games remaining. However, Boro played one game less than most teams also vying for a top-six spot.
The bookmakers’ second favorite is former England manager Sam Allardyce. The 67-year-old has been out of a job since leaving West Bromwich Albion last year, failing to save them from relegation.
The Clarets are currently managed by Under-23 manager Mike Jackson, who oversaw Sunday’s 1-1 draw at West Ham United at the London Stadium.
They are currently three points from safety, with their next match being Thursday night at home against Southampton. Meanwhile Everton, currently sitting in 17 and are also in action midweek, hosting Leicester City on Wednesday night.
Jackson is not currently on SkyBet’s shortlist to replace Dyche, but there are plenty of familiar faces behind Wilder and Allardyce in the bookies race.

Bodo/Glimt boss Kjetil Knutsen is the third favorite with SkyBet for the role at 9/1. Next on the list are Derby County manager Wayne Rooney and former Wolverhampton Wanderers and Tottenham Hotspur boss, both priced at 10/1.
Cheltenham Town boss Michael Duff is a surprise long shot for the role. The former Burnley defender, who has impressed in recent years with the Robins, is priced at 12/1.
Other longshots include former Liverpool and Chelsea manager Rafa Benitez (18/1), former West Ham manager Slaven Bilic (20/1) and Burnley captain Ben Mee (25/1) who was part of from the Burnley coaching staff for West Ham’s draw. due to injury.
